虚拟技术在舰船动力装置训练中的应用研究 被引量:2

Study on the application of the virtual technology on training of marine power plant
下载PDF
导出
摘要 随着计算机软硬件技术的发展,虚拟技术在各个领域得到了广泛的应用。针对舰船动力装置的特点和传统训练方法的不足,文章研究将虚拟技术应用于舰船动力装置训练,包括舰船动力装置的结构原理培训、操作使用培训、装备维修训练等内容;同时,对舰船动力装置虚拟训练的技术实现方案及关键技术进行了深入分析,并以实例对训练功能的可实现性进行了验证。通过该方法的采用,不仅能够满足训练任务的需要,而且节约经费、缩短训练周期,具有非常重要的意义。 With the development of technology for computer software and hardware, virtual technology is widely used in many fields. A new method with virtual technology on training of marine power plant is studied, including the study of the structures of components, the operating and virtual maintenance training. In addition, the technical approach and the key problems are discussed in detail. The feasibility of training functions is also validated by examples. In this way, marine training requirements can be met with, and much cost and time can be saved as well. This is very meaningful.
